• 女程序员go语言是什么

    女程序员使用Go语言的原因有以下几个:1、语言特性,2、职业发展,3、社区支持,4、工作需求,5、个人兴趣。 其中,语言特性是许多女程序员选择Go语言的重要原因。Go语言由Google开发,具有简洁的语法、强大的并发处理能力以及高效的编译速度,适合构建高性能的网络和分布式系统。它还提供了强大的标准库…

    2024年10月30日
  • 知乎为什么用go语言

    知乎选择使用Go语言是基于以下几个核心原因:1、高并发处理能力,2、高性能,3、易于维护和开发,4、良好的生态系统。其中,高并发处理能力是特别重要的,因为知乎作为一个大型的社交问答平台,需要处理大量用户的请求,Go语言的协程机制可以有效提高并发处理能力,减少系统资源的消耗。 一、高并发处理能力 Go…

    2024年10月30日
  • go语言大型项目用什么框架

    1、Gin,2、Beego,3、Echo,4、Revel 在选择Go语言框架时,Gin是一个非常流行且高效的选择。它的性能极高,适用于构建高并发的Web应用。Gin的设计理念是轻量级和简洁,提供了丰富的中间件支持,能够快速开发RESTful API。Gin的路由机制非常灵活,可以根据不同的需求进行定…

    2024年10月30日
  • go语言什么时候加泛型

    Go语言在其1.18版本中正式引入了泛型。这一变更标志着Go语言在提升代码复用性和类型安全性方面迈出了重要一步。1、Go 1.18版本引入了泛型,2、泛型支持提升了代码复用性和类型安全性,3、Go泛型通过类型参数和类型约束实现。为了更好地理解这一点,我们将详细探讨Go泛型的实现方式及其对开发者的影响…

    2024年10月30日
  • go语言特殊技巧是什么

    Go语言(也称为Golang)因其简洁和高效的特点,已经成为许多开发者的首选编程语言。1、并发编程模型、2、垃圾回收、3、简单的语法结构、4、内置的测试工具、5、接口类型是Go语言的一些特殊技巧。下面,我们将详细讨论其中的并发编程模型。 Go语言的并发编程模型是其最大的亮点之一。Go通过gorout…

    2024年10月30日
  • go语言实现推荐算法是什么

    在Go语言中实现推荐算法的方式有多种,常见的有1、基于内容的推荐算法,2、协同过滤算法,3、混合推荐算法。基于内容的推荐算法使用用户与项目特征之间的相似性来推荐项目。协同过滤算法基于用户行为数据,利用用户与用户或项目与项目之间的相似性进行推荐。混合推荐算法结合了多种推荐策略,以提高推荐结果的准确性和…

    2024年10月30日
  • go语言为什么在大陆火

    Go语言在大陆火的原因可以归结为以下几点:1、简单易学;2、高性能;3、良好的并发支持;4、强大的社区支持;5、企业广泛采用。其中,简单易学是一个重要的因素。Go语言的设计哲学注重简洁和易用,其语法和结构都非常直观,适合初学者快速上手。这使得大量开发者能够迅速掌握并应用于实际项目,从而推动了Go语言…

    2024年10月30日
  • go语言一般用什么软件

    Go语言的开发通常使用多种软件来提高效率和方便性。1、Visual Studio Code、2、GoLand、3、Sublime Text、4、Vim、5、Atom是五个最常见的选择。其中,Visual Studio Code(VS Code)因其强大的扩展性和用户友好性,成为许多Go开发者的首选。…

    2024年10月30日
  • go语言为什么要反着写

    Go语言在某些地方看起来像是“反着写”的原因主要有以下几点:1、声明语法独特,2、文法简洁,3、代码可读性高。这些设计选择都旨在提高代码的可读性和可维护性。声明语法独特这一点尤其值得深入探讨。在Go语言中,类型声明在变量名之后,这种设计借鉴了C语言中的函数声明方式,使得变量的声明和函数签名更为一致。…

    2024年10月30日
  • go为什么这么多语言

    Go语言之所以有这么多语言特性,主要原因有以下几点:1、简洁和高效的设计,2、强大的并发支持,3、良好的工具链和生态系统。在这其中,简洁和高效的设计是最关键的,因为它使得开发者可以更快速地编写和维护代码。 一、简洁和高效的设计 Go语言的设计理念是“少即是多”,它去除了许多复杂的特性,使得语言本身变…

    2024年10月30日
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部